Basketball, Boys: Thirds loses to Choate

Event Details

On Saturday, February 22nd, the boys 3rds basketball team hosted archrival Choate Rosemary Hall for a 2 pm tipoff. In a season full of heartbreaking losses, this might have been the worst. Despite overcoming a disastrous 1-28 shooting performance in the 1st half and holding a 4-point lead with 2 minutes left in the game, Deerfield lost 32-30. The loss to CRH dropped the team’s record to 2-12 on the season, with one game left. The good news was that Deerfield’s defense was stout throughout the game, namely the half-court press, which led to numerous turnovers. CRH was held scoreless for the first 7 minutes of the game, but Deerfield could only build a 4-0 lead during that time. Eventually, the field goal drought caught up to them and they trailed 14-7 at the half. As it did against NMH, the offense came alive in the 2nd half and Deerfield finally took the lead back with 10:52 left in the game. Just when it seemed that Deerfield would run away with the game, the field goal shooting went cold again and CRH hit a clutch 3-pointer and several free throws to seal the game. Jack Chorske ’22 led the team with 13 points, his personal best for the season. The boys 3rds team will close out their season on the road, with a 2:45 start on February 26th against Loomis.
